Relaxation dynamics of the Ising $p$-spin disordered model with finite number of variables

Abstract
We study the dynamic and metastable properties of the fully connected Ising $p$-spin model with finite number of variables. We define trapping energies, trapping times and self correlation functions and we analyse their statistical properties in comparison to the predictions of trap models.
